Late Neoproterozoic through Silurian tectonic evolution of the Rödingsfjället Nappe Complex, orogen-scale correlations and implications for the Scandian suture

The Scandinavian Caledonides consist of disparate nappes of Baltican and exotic heritage, thrust southeastwards onto Baltica during Mid-Silurian Scandian continent-continent collision, with structurally higher nappes inferred to have originated at increasingly distal positions to Baltica.
